Detained NAF Aircraft Resumes Maintenance Flight After Diplomatic Intervention
[The Whistler - Nigeria] - 23/12/2025
The Nigerian Air Force confirmed that its C-130 aircraft on a ferry flight for scheduled depot maintenance landed safely in Banjul, The Gambia, 14 days after detention. The aircraft resumed its trip after earlier making a precautionary landing in Bobo-Dioulasso, Burkina Faso, on December 8 due (…)
